2.0 PURPOSE 2.1 It is the purpose of Random RT Welder Surveillence Program to utilize radiography as a means to insure that the welders employed at CPSES are capable of maintaining the same level of proficiency under field production conditions as they,_have_previously_demop strated during qualification tes_t_i_ng.

( CPSES NUMBER REVIS ION DATE PACE JOB 35-1195 WEI-1 3 07/30/84 '2 of 5 2.2 This program is not intended to be used to evaluate weld joint integrity. Weld joint integrity is to be determined by the NDE

methods designated by design specifications in accordance with the applicable codes. NDE as prescribed by this specification is performed and interpretated by certified Quality Control Inspectors. The Random RT Welders Surveillance Program is not applicable to those systems that require volumetric inspections or SWA's (System Work Authorization's) to perform modifications a fter inital installation and acceptance by the Owner.

5.2 MAINTENANCE

a. A record listing the ASME Class III and BOP Class V pipe velds made by individual welders shall be maintained by
  • the Welding Engineering WPC.-
b. Welds for each welder shall be listed in lots of twenty (20).

Five (5) Lots or one-hundred (100) welds equals one(!)

( group.

U c. A minimum of one(1) weld from each tot (5%) shall be selected by the WPC for RT.

d. If a welder is charged with a reject, two(2) additional'l welds from the same lot shall be selected for RT.
e. If at any time a welder is assigned two(2) rejects in any one(1) Lot, the welder's certification for the welding procedure shall be evaluated by the Project Welding Engineer as to whether the welder's certification should be suspendedy or revoked. '[
Y'
f. If a welder's certification is suspended or revoked a meno shall be forwarded to the Pipe Department indicatirg the specifics of the revocation or suspension. A copy of the same a

memo shall be sent to WDCC, WQTC, QC and all Rod Shacks.

g. Upon reinstatesent of a welder's certification a meno shall be sent to all parties on distribution of the memo referenced in 5.2. f. An interim authorization memo shall also be given to the welder by the WQTC.

i tn BROWN & ROOT, INC. PROCEDURE EFFECTIVE CPSES NUMBER REVISION DATE PAGE JOB 35-1195 WEI-1 3 07/30/84 4 of 5 5.3 WELD SELECTION Welds designated as Class III and BOP Class V shall be selected for RI by the Welder Performance Coordinator in accordance with the following:

a. Welds accomplished by only one(1) welder shall be given first priority for selection. I
b. Welds accomplished by two(2) or more welders shall be given

{.,. second priority for selection.

. c. All other selections are assigned third priority.

d. If one(l) selected weld, accomplished by two(2) or more welders passes RT, it will count as one(l) acceptable weld for each participating welder.
e. Welders making only tack welds shall not be counted in the Welders Surveillance Program.

,,, f. Repair welds shall not be selected for the Welder Surveillance Program.

5.3.1 Selection of Class III Shop and Field

. a. Weld Data Cards for Class III welds completed in the shop V

and field shall be transmitted to the PFG in the normal l ma nner. These cards shall be reviewed by the Welder Performance Coordinator. A copy of the weld data card for those welds selected shall be forwarded to the Pipe Department RT Coordinator by three part meno. The original l weld data card shall be placed in an "RT Hold File" in the PFG.

b. The Pipe Department RT Coordinator shall notify the area foreman and submit the RT request to QCRT stamped " Random".

5.3.2 Selection of BOP Class V Welds

a. A list of completed BOP Class y welds which do not require 100% RT shall be submitted to the Welder Performance Coordinator o'n a regular basis by the C.I.T. group.

5.4 ACCEPTANCE CRITERIA The acceptability of welds examined by radiography shall be

  • determined as follows:
a. Any type of crack or zone of incomplete fusion or penetration shall be unacceptable.

g b. Non-metallic inclusions (slag) shall be unacceptable if the length of any such indication is greater then 2/3 T where T is the thickness of the thinner section being joined.

If two(2) or more indications within the above limitations exist in a line, the weld shall be judged acceptable if

, the sum of the longest dimensions of all indications is not more than T in a length of 6T or proportionately for welds less than 6T and if the longest indications considered are separated by at least 3 L where L is the length of accep-table indications of 3/4 inch (.750"). Any such indication less than 1/4 inch (.250") shall be acceptable for any weld thick ne ss.

c. Porosity is not a factor in the acceptability of welds selected for this program.

i DCP9 - cat 41 summary malonson 10/27/84 ALLEGATION

SUMMARY

1. Category No. : 41 TRT Member: J. H. Malonson
2.

Subject:

Improper implementation of radiograph program.

3. Sumary of Allegation: It was alleged that:

AQW-8 (unknown) - The alleger was directed to falsify reports.

AQW-9 (unknown) - There was improper implementation of a random radiograph testing program.

AQW-79 - Radiographs were not taken of lift gate weld connection.

4. Region IV's

Conclusions:

AQW-8 and AQW (OI-IR-79-12) Radiograph review program not an NRC requirement.

AQW No R IV documentation found on this allegation.

5. What the TRT has done: The TRT:

AQW-8 and AQW Reviewed the random radiograph program.

AQW Reviewed specifications, drawings, welding reports, interviewed the B/R welding engineer and QC personnel, and performed field examination.

~

..%, 3

6. TRT

Conclusions:

I AQW-8 and AQW The TRT verified that the random radiograph review

program was a management tool to measure welder performance. It was l not an NRC or code requirement.

AQW The TRT found the required radiographs had been taken and, I

therefore, the allegation was without merit.
